+/*
|
|
|
+ * The PF_FREEZER_SKIP flag should be set by a vfork parent right before it
|
|
|
+ * calls wait_for_completion(&vfork) and reset right after it returns from this
|
|
|
+ * function. Next, the parent should call try_to_freeze() to freeze itself
|
|
|
+ * appropriately in case the child has exited before the freezing of tasks is
|
|
|
+ * complete. However, we don't want kernel threads to be frozen in unexpected
|
|
|
+ * places, so we allow them to block freeze_processes() instead or to set
|
|
|
+ * PF_NOFREEZE if needed and PF_FREEZER_SKIP is only set for userland vfork
|
|
|
+ * parents. Fortunately, in the ____call_usermodehelper() case the parent won't
|
|
|
+ * really block freeze_processes(), since ____call_usermodehelper() (the child)
|
|
|
+ * does a little before exec/exit and it can't be frozen before waking up the
|
|
|
+ * parent.
|
|
|
+ */
|
|
|
+
|
|
|
+/*
|
|
|
+ * If the current task is a user space one, tell the freezer not to count it as
|
|
|
+ * freezable.
|
|
|
+ */
|
|
|
+static inline void freezer_do_not_count(void)
|
|
|
+{
|
|
|
+ if (current->mm)
|
|
|
+ current->flags |= PF_FREEZER_SKIP;
|
|
|
+}
|
|
|
+
|
|
|
+/*
|
|
|
+ * If the current task is a user space one, tell the freezer to count it as
|
|
|
+ * freezable again and try to freeze it.
|
|
|
+ */
|
|
|
+static inline void freezer_count(void)
|
|
|
+{
|
|
|
+ if (current->mm) {
|
|
|
+ current->flags &= ~PF_FREEZER_SKIP;
|
|
|
+ try_to_freeze();
|
|
|
+ }
|
|
|
+}
|
|
|
+
|
|
|
+/*
|
|
|
+ * Check if the task should be counted as freezeable by the freezer
|
|
|
+ */
|
|
|
+static inline int freezer_should_skip(struct task_struct *p)
|
|
|
+{
|
|
|
+ return !!(p->flags & PF_FREEZER_SKIP);
|
|
|
+}
